Output ec0326fc0c9749cff5db64bc73df217648d50258cff91d0b25d72fe9ec394c44:39

value
147000
script pubkey
OP_0 OP_PUSHBYTES_20 268f85336056b31b121eede5cc7bb5326186cd3d
address
bc1qy68c2vmq26e3kys7ahjuc7a4xfscdnfan77ed6
transaction
ec0326fc0c9749cff5db64bc73df217648d50258cff91d0b25d72fe9ec394c44
spent
true